it's really hard to predict what the new coaching staff and possibly general manager (though I think hurney hangs around) will value.

if for example they were to get a guy like brian schottenheimer (and hopefully his dad to DC) i could see them going AJ Green.

however, if they get someone like Leslie Frazier from Minnesota, it'd almost certainly be the BPA b/w DT and CB. Marshall is gone after this year, and they haven't had consistent pressure up the middle since Jenkins decided he didn't give a f**k.

I personally think we take Patrick Peterson or AJ Green (or another SOLID WR talent). Obviously, as previously stated, Marshall is gone (he's a nickle corner, at best). Munnerlyn is a nickle. Period. And he's better at nickle than Marshall, which is WHY he is gone. And clearly, we need talent at the WR position. Also, I believe I called the Clausen/Gettis chemistry last week after Clausen was named the starter, and it seemed today that my assessment may be accurate. Regardless, Gettis's ceiling is #2, and that's with high hopes. Slot receiver is probably more accurate, and we need somebody who can replace Smith eventually and complement him at the time right now.

So, now the flip side. If we DON'T do what I stated in the above paragraph, we take DL. Whether or not its DE or DT, we need help at both, so either is fine by me. Personally, I think we need solid, consistent DT play more than anything (especially at the 3 technique, or for those of you who don't understand, the DT that plays outside shoulder of the guard). Hardy is a solid pass rusher, as is Brown. I think Hardy could be easier to groom as a run stopper as well than Brown, given Hardy is a little bigger than Brown.
